Step 4. After you apply
As soon as we confirm that you are eligible for the Service, a qualified financial consultant will be assigned to work with you throughout the mediation process. The consultant will visit your farm to learn how your operation works, then will:
- assess your current financial situation
- explore options and develop a plan for the future
- collect financial information to prepare a financial statement and recovery plan
- complete projections to evaluate the viability of the plan
- contact creditors to verify amounts owed
- attend the mediation meeting and assist you with negotiations
Service standards
Due to the extraordinary circumstances caused by COVID-19, it is anticipated that the delivery of services will take longer than the published service standard.
Once you submit an application, our goal is to achieve our service standards at a minimum of 80% of the time under normal circumstances:
- Our goal is to respond to general inquiries made to our phone number or email address before the end of the next business day;
- Our goal is to notify you if your application has been accepted or not by the end of the next business day;
- Our goal is to have all necessary documentation sent to creditors and producer seven (7) business days prior to the mediation meeting;
- Our goal is to schedule the first mediation meeting within 70 calendar days after acceptance of your application.
